AVGO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

3,816 of the 7,459 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Broadcom (AVGO)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$604B — down 28% from $842B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 276 funds closed out of AVGO and 247 opened new positions — a net loss of 29 holders — while 1,542 trimmed existing stakes and 1,771 added.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$3.81B. The largest seller was Capital World Investors, cutting an estimated $8.86B.
